High School Names Top Students

Emily Dorso and Saniya Khan earn senior class top spots.

Emily Dorso has been named the valedictorian and Saniya Khan has been named salutatorian of the Class of 2011.

Dorso has taken a rigorous class schedule including many AP courses and is graduating with a GPA of 104.187. She is president of the Spanish Honor Society, a four year member of the Wind Ensemble, an all-state flute player and has been the drum major for the award winning Marching Band for the last two years.

Khan is graduating with a GPA of 103.855 and has received a 96 or above on all ten of the New York State Regents Exams that she has taken. She is president of the school’s Interact Club and organized a fundraiser this year to help those in Pakistan who were affected by the deadly monsoon last summer.

Dorso will be attending the University of Tampa in the fall. Khan is accepting an offer into the Honor Program at Molloy College.
